About MSFC 2026
The Massey Sustainable Finance Conference (MSFC) brings together leading researchers, practitioners, and visionaries to share groundbreaking work in crossroad of Finance and Sustainability

Massey Business School - School of Accountancy, Economics and Finance
Massey Business School is one of New Zealand’s leading and largest business schools and has been an integral part of New Zealand for 50 years.With campuses in Auckland, Palmerston North and Wellington, we offer study and research across all aspects of business expertise and leadership. We provide on-campus, online and blended learning options for domestic and international students. Many of our postgraduate qualifications are designed for people already in work, including part-time and online options so our students can balance study with their jobs. Because the business world changes fast, we also focus on critical thinking and building resilience and adaptability in our graduates.

SAEF's Sustainable Finance Cluster
Sustainable Finance Cluster (SFC) is a research cluster operating within the School of Accountancy, Economics and Finance, Massey University. The scope of SFC-SEF covers several important and current issues that link Finance and Sustainability together, including climate finance, green finance, (renewable) energy finance, corporate social responsibility, and ESG (Environmental, Social and Governance)
